BMW N20 oil change
PSA:
When changing engine oil, please pour the entire 5L's in the engine. (N20 engine). Some people are pouring 4.8L's which is not enough. Speaking from experience. Only when we pour in the entire 5L's of engine oil, the oil sensor relays the appropriate engine oil level (right below MAX). Otherwise, it is below the MIN mark which requires more oil to be poured in. Not sure if this was mentioned here already.
